Altruistic behaviors are “unselfish” behaviors—those that help another individual at the expense of the individual carrying out the behavior. Despite the negative consequences for the altruistic animal, these behaviors are thought to have evolved for several reasons.

Standard precautions are the minimum infection control safeguards used while caring for all patients, irrespective of their disease condition. They help prevent the spread of common infectious microorganisms to healthcare workers, patients, and visitors in all healthcare settings.

Area of Science:

  • Philosophy
  • Public Health
  • Sociology

Background:

  • The COVID-19 pandemic necessitated global cooperation and shared responsibility.
  • The phrase "We are all in this together" gained prominence in North America and Europe.
  • Ubuntu philosophy emphasizes interconnectedness and communal well-being.

Purpose of the Study:

  • To analyze the connection between Ubuntu philosophy and the expression "We are all in this together" during the COVID-19 pandemic.
  • To explore how Ubuntu's concept of relational solidarity influenced pandemic response messaging.

Main Methods:

  • Philosophical analysis of Ubuntu's core tenets.
  • Discourse analysis of the phrase "We are all in this together" in public health contexts.
  • Comparative study of cultural philosophies and their impact on collective action.

Main Results:

  • The expression "We are all in this together" directly or indirectly reflects Ubuntu's philosophy of relational solidarity.
  • Pandemic mitigation strategies are strengthened by acknowledging shared responsibility and collaboration.
  • Ubuntu's philosophy provides a framework for understanding collective efficacy in global crises.

Conclusions:

  • The COVID-19 pandemic demonstrated the practical application of Ubuntu's philosophy in public health.
  • "We are all in this together" serves as a modern articulation of ancient principles of communal interdependence.
  • Embracing relational solidarity is crucial for navigating future global health challenges.
